21 Enable this option to build the Linux Infrared Remote
22 Control (LIRC) core device interface driver. The LIRC
23 interface passes raw IR to and from userspace, where the
24 LIRC daemon handles protocol decoding for IR reception and
25 encoding for IR transmitting (aka "blasting").

78 config IR_RC5_SZ_DECODER
79 tristate "Enable IR raw decoder for the RC-5 (streamzap) protocol"
85 Enable this option if you have IR with RC-5 (streamzap) protocol,
86 and if the IR is decoded in software. (The Streamzap PC Remote
87 uses an IR protocol that is almost standard RC-5, but not quite,
88 as it uses an additional bit).

139 tristate "Nuvoton w836x7hg Consumer Infrared Transceiver"
143 Say Y here to enable support for integrated infrared receiver
144 /transciever made by Nuvoton (formerly Winbond). This chip is
145 found in the ASRock ION 330HT, as well as assorted Intel
146 DP55-series motherboards (and of course, possibly others).
148 To compile this driver as a module, choose M here: the
149 module will be called nuvoton-cir.
